Rules for working with leather

Initially, you need to know the rules of working with this or that material. That is why, before figuring out how to sew a leather bag, you need to know all the nuances and precautions in the work.

  1. To use a sewing machine you will need special needles. In some cases, you can also install a special foot (with a roller) for sewing leather products.
  2. For each product you need to be able to choose leather. So, for bags it should be extremely thick, rough-made. Only in this case will the product be able to serve its owner for a longer time.
  3. When cutting parts, remember that leather stretches differently.
  4. Throwing or pinning skin is prohibited. After all, marks remain on it, which then do not disappear anywhere.
  5. The length of the machine stitch when working with leather should be as wide as possible. After all, if you sew a bag with a fine stitch, the leather may simply tear (press through) in the stitching areas, which will lead to the product tearing.
  6. It is better to cut the leather not with tailor's scissors, but with a special shoemaker's or stationery knife.
  7. The edges of the leather are not overlocked. After all, they do not have the property of rolling.
  8. Standard machine fastenings are not applied to leather. To prevent the product from coming apart at the seams, the thread on the wrong side must be tied into a knot.
  9. It is important to remember that high-quality sewing of leather products is simply impossible without the use of glue.

Ironing the product

Sewing leather bags necessarily includes the process of ironing the material. There are certain nuances here:

  1. The leather is ironed from the wrong side.
  2. When ironing you should use low temperatures, steaming should not be used. Overheating causes the skin to shrink and become hard. It will not be possible to soften it after this.
  3. It is best to iron the skin, even from the wrong side, through gauze or a special iron. This way you can protect the fabric from damage.

Envelope clutch

Today it is fashion accessory, which simply must be in the wardrobe of every self-respecting girl. In addition, making it yourself is quite simple.

To make a perfect leather bag with your own hands, patterns are a must. After all, it is much easier to create a product using a template than to sew it, as they say, by touch. In this case, the template is extremely simple: the design is based on a rectangle (its size is the size of the clutch). Next, you need to draw triangles in four directions from the sides. However, so that their edges do not coincide a little, they are wider (this is important, because when folding the clutch, things should not fall out of the bag).

Next, the product is cut out. At the next stage, holes are punched at the edges using a special device (a hole punch for fabrics). Three edges are folded to form an envelope. They are fixed with a rivet (threaded through the holes and secured on top with a round piece). The principle is something similar to a bolt and nut. The remaining piece of fabric is the “lid” of the bag, i.e. the part that will open in order to put or take something into the clutch.

Shopping bag

It is also extremely easy to sew this leather bag with your own hands. You don't even need patterns here. For sewing, you need two rectangular pieces of leather for the bag itself, two long narrow pieces for the handles. If you wish, you can make a lining.

At the very beginning, you need to sew two equal pieces of leather from the bottom and sides. This will be the bag itself. Next you need to prepare the handles. They are easy to make too. You need to fold a piece of leather in half, bend the edges of the handle into the middle so that everything looks beautiful on the outside. The handles can be initially glued with doublerin, which will significantly strengthen them. Next, they need to be stitched along the edge to secure them.

Then the handles should be sewn to the bag itself. To do this, the top of the product needs to be slightly bent into the middle. The handles are sewn a little along the length (to the top of the bag) and always along the width. In this case, threads for sewing can be chosen either to match the product or in a contrasting color. That's all. The leather shopping bag is ready!

Leather bag care

Having examined various patterns of leather bags, photos of finished products, finally it must be said that any item made of this material requires special care.

You can revive a slightly tarnished or faded leather bag with a soap solution. However, before use, you need to add a little ammonia to it. After treatment with this product, the bag is thoroughly wiped and rubbed until shiny. soft cloth, soaked in castor oil or glycerin. Next, apply a thin layer of colorless cream to the bag. After it is absorbed, the product is wiped with flannel.

An onion can also be a good way to refresh your bag. To do this, you need to take half of this vegetable and rub the product with the cut. This product also perfectly hides scuffs on a leather bag, minor scratches and cracks.

If the leather bag becomes shiny, this area should be wiped with a mixture of milk and baking soda. Preparing the solution is simple. Mix a teaspoon of soda in a glass of milk.

If the bag is made of suede, i.e. reverse leather, it also needs to be properly cared for. Such a product should be periodically wiped with a rubberized cloth or an eraser. You should not wash the material, as this will make it rougher. However, if necessary, the suede should be washed in a soapy solution, wiping it thoroughly after the procedure.

In this master class we will tell you all the sewing technology men's bags from genuine leather with your own hands.

Making such a men's bag (size 22x17x10) is not as difficult as it might seem. The product is made of crust and has two convenient compartments inside and a pocket for small items, located on the lid. If you are working withsoft skin, glue it in two layers on the walls, lid and jumper between the compartments. This way you can maintain the shape of the product.

First, let's make a pattern for the front and back parts of the bag and pocket. Mark the locations of the buckle, pocket, and also calculate how far the flap will extend to the front edge of the bag.

Pocket on the inside of the lid.

The pocket is made from any suitable leather. If the material is soft, glue it in two layers, stitch along the edge with nylon thread so that the pocket does not lose its shape. Install a magnetic clasp or button.

Front wall of the bag.

Place the pattern on the leather and trace it with an awl to leave a mark. Make two parts if you are going to glue thin leather. Sew along the top edge of the wall.

Attach the strap with a buckle to the front wall using a couple of threads.

Back wall and lid of the bag.

The same pattern will be used for the front and back of the bag and for the internal jumper. To apply it to the back layer of the skin, use a marker. When making the back wall, extend the outline of the pattern by 10cm (the width of the bag). Cover length 14.5 cm.

For the bag you will need two parts of each type.

To prevent the pocket from slipping while working, glue it along the contour, then stitch it to the product and fasten one piece at the top corners for strength.

On the outside we attach a clasp strap for the future bag. It will be 60cm long and the same width as the strap on which we previously installed the buckle. on his reverse side you need to glue the lining, and 20 cm of the product from the side of the rounded end needs to be stitched along the edge.

Glue the outer and inner parts together so that the pocket is on the lid under the protruding part of the strap. Measure 22 cm from the bottom of the bag and stitch the rest of the edge.

We cut out two parts of the jumpers and glue them together so that one is 0.5 cm smaller than the other. This will allow you to sew fewer layers of leather when assembling the bag.

Side walls.

Marking 2 parts for the side wall (length 64 cm, width 6 cm, margins 0.5 cm for seams). Let's cut out a couple of rectangles measuring 4x13 cm with rounded corners and glue them in the center of the finished parts for rigidity. Glue strips of lining 5 cm wide onto the finished parts.

We trim the rectangles around the edge.

We bend the edges at the side walls with pliers.

We glue both parts along the edge on both sides to the jumper, starting from the middle. And we trim off the excess edges that will protrude beyond the top of the jumper.

We will make the side seams by hand, since making them on a machine is quite difficult. To do this, we first pierce the leather with an awl, and then sew the product along the finished basting. Take blunt needles - with them it is easier to get into the finished hole and not damage the skin of the bag with new punctures.

Rub the finished seam along the end of the leather with transparent shoe wax.

Side half rings.

Each half ring will require a fastening piece. We cut it out, thread it into a half ring and glue it, folding it in half. You can install a holniten.

On each part, use an awl to outline the location of the future seam and glue the edge of the part onto the side wall of the bag, over the seam. Sew it on.

Sew on the front wall.

Starting from the middle of the front wall, glue it to the side, sew by hand, don't forget to make a few stitches at the end of the seam.

Sew on the back wall.

At the end of sewing, rub all open ends of the leather with wax.

Shoulder strap.

The optimal belt length is 160 cm, select the width according to your fittings. Glue the lining fabric from the inside and stitch. If you don't have a piece of leather for a one-piece belt, make one from several pieces fastened together.

To adjust the length of the belt, fasten one end of it to the middle jumper of the fastex, and pass the other through the ring and through the fastex.

The following fabric options may be most suitable for a bag:

  1. Canvas– canvas is an extremely durable material used for making sails. If earlier this variety was produced from hemp, today it is made from synthetic fibers.
  2. Cordura- material used by American tailors for sewing military equipment. Durable and durable material, the wear resistance of which is 5 times higher than nylon.
  3. Denim– denim, a durable fabric that does not allow dust to pass through and lasts a very long time. Combines with any type of decoration, guipure lace, embroidery, decorative details.
  4. Lake– original fabric reminiscent of leather, shiny and smooth. The industry produces plain varnish or covered with a patterned print. The fabric is durable, does not allow moisture to pass through, and has a low cost.
  5. Plain gabardine, with which decorative elements are perfectly combined. A bag made from this fabric can be washed frequently, appearance the product will not lose its attractiveness.
  6. Oxford– backpack fabric with increased strength.
  7. You can also use light fabrics - linen, silk, cotton, the colors of which are extremely rich. With this option, you will need to select fabric for the lining.

Felt pattern

Felt bags are becoming increasingly popular because they are beautiful, bright, soft and cozy.

Working with felt is easy:

  1. The material does not stretch, so there is no need to draw a pattern. Having decided on the size of the product, you can simply cut out two squares or the same number of rectangles and get to work.
  2. The edges of the fabric do not fray, so there is no need for additional processing of seams.
  3. After basting and sewing the bag, you need to think about the handles for it. Options can be different: from the same felt, thin chain, belt.
  4. To make the product look neat, it is better to sew a contrasting color lining that will hide the internal seams.
  5. All that remains is to complement the sample with decor. It can be made from felt fabric of a different color. The cut out funny figure is simply glued or sewn with an overcast stitch.

Fur and suede for bag pattern

Sew a bag with your own hands (master class), different models are easy from fur, suede itself simple design, which always look rich. You want to pick them up and try them on with your outfit. To create such an exclusive piece, you will need some leftover fur, natural or artificial, which will not be easy to work with.

Most likely it will be painstaking handmade. When sewing fur product on a typewriter, the work progresses slowly: the fibers fall under the needle. In addition, you need a machine that sews thick fabrics.

If the desire to have a fur bag has not disappeared, then you will have to do the following:

  1. You will need a pattern.
  2. After it is done, the existing fur is laid out in the direction of the pile and pattern.
  3. The elements of the future product are placed on it parallel to the center of the cut. Outline the parts with an automatic pen so that the line is visible.
  4. You need to be careful so that fur defects do not fall under the pattern.
  5. Fur, like suede, cannot be cut with scissors. You should have a furrier's knife at hand.
  6. You need to grind down the parts according to how the pile looks. All lint should be hidden under the seams.
  7. The process can only be performed with a sharp, rather thick needle, using nylon threads. You only need to pierce fur or suede once.

How to sew a leather bag with your own hands?


The size of the finished bag is 42 by 36 cm. It consists of two parts that must first be cut out. They will turn out like this.


Each of them measures 50 by 38 cm. Leave one centimeter for the seams, and add 5 cm on top for the hem. Bottom corners These triangles should be rounded. To do this, take a regular roll of tape, place it here and outline it.


Then you will need to mark the darts so that the bag gains volume. These angles are 45 degrees.


The length of the dart is 3 cm. Take the Moment glue and attach the dart with it. After this, let the solution dry and you can stitch in this place. Then use glue to connect the parts if your bag also consists of four rectangles.


Once the glue has dried, stitch along these areas and then tap with a mallet to smooth out the leather on the seams.

Apply a little Moment glue to the back of the allowances and fix them in a horizontal position.


Now you will need to make decorative stitches along the main seams.


Speaking about how to make a bag with your own hands, it should be noted that it is necessary to periodically apply a ruler to the perimeter and level it, cutting off the excess.


You need to cut out the lining according to the size of the sewn bag. If you are making a knapsack with a pocket, then you need to make this part out of lining fabric.


Place two pieces for the pocket on one and the other half of the bag and sew, connecting them together with a seam.


Then you will need to sew it on a machine, at the same time sewing a zipper on the pocket.


Sew a lining with a pocket to the size of the bag.


Now we need to make the handles.

To remove excess thickness from the handles, remove some of the suede from the underside with a sharp blade.



Fold each handle in half crosswise and stitch on the wrong side. Then turn it right side out. Set aside the edges of the handles.


If you have previously sewn the lining on top to the bag, then carefully cut at the top, insert a handle here and stitch.


If not, then insert the edges of the handle between the lining and the leather, and then topstitch the product.
